Miles Overview
The Tundra is Toyota's full-size pickup, the one you cross-shop with the Ford F-150 and Chevrolet Silverado. It drives with a confident, planted feel whether you're hauling gear or towing a trailer, and the turning radius is surprisingly tight for a truck this size. Inside, the cabin is roomy and comfortable, with plenty of headroom and legroom even for tall drivers, and the controls are straightforward. Reliability is a strong point, though some owners have dealt with recalls for frame rust and airbags, and a few have replaced water pumps around 50,000 miles. The Limited adds leather upholstery, power-adjustable pedals, and a JBL audio system over the SR5, making it the luxury pick in the Tundra lineup. Its 5.7L V8 makes 381 horsepower and pairs with an automatic transmission and four-wheel drive, so you get strong passing power and confident traction on loose surfaces. Expect 14 mpg combined around town; the trade-off is the effortless towing capability that full-size V8 buyers are after.
